抄録

The purposes of the paper are to clarify 1) how ‘sports’ came to be recognized as object of scientific study in the course of its development, and 2) what led to this situation.
Methodologically, while basing our inquiry on the “play theory” that is the foundation of sports culture, we examined how the progressive thought that arose due to the cause-effect mechanistic perspective that developed in the modern era from the cycles philosophy of the organismic teleology of Aristotle left its mark on sports.
As a result, it was made clear that, when viewed from the link to sports science, the “formulation” of sports resulted in the preparation of “quantification” and “standardization” in the execution of sports, making possible the consideration of sports from an “objective perspective.” This can be thought of as having deepened the link with the scientism that was methodologically put together using the cause-effect mechanistic perspective that arose in the modern era. Also, it can be said that as a result of this, only the “inevitability” for a chancedenying “desire for invincibility” has become to be required as a sports science theory.
It can also be said that this elimination of “chance,” even given the state of sports from the past, is an opportunity for the transformation of sports by eliminating its “play nature.”
